US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"ultimately connected with"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it to describe a relationship or association that is fundamental or final in nature. Example: "The success of the project is ultimately connected with the team's ability to collaborate effectively."

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

When using "ultimately connected with", ensure that the connection you are describing is a fundamental or final one. Avoid using it for superficial or temporary associations.

Common error

Avoid using "ultimately connected with" when describing connections that are merely coincidental or have little long-term impact. Overusing the phrase can dilute its meaning and make your writing sound hyperbolic.

Linguistic Context

The phrase "ultimately connected with" functions as a linking phrase, establishing a relationship between two or more elements. It signifies that one element's final state or outcome is fundamentally related or tied to another. According to Ludwig AI, this phrase is grammatically correct and suitable for use in writing.

FAQs

How can I use "ultimately connected with" in a sentence?

Use "ultimately connected with" to describe a fundamental or final relationship between two things. For instance, "The success of the project is ultimately connected with the team's ability to collaborate effectively."

What's the difference between "ultimately connected with" and "loosely associated with"?

"Ultimately connected with" implies a strong, fundamental relationship, while "loosely associated with" suggests a weak or superficial connection. Choose the phrase that accurately reflects the strength of the relationship you're describing.
